Accidentally Changed my groups.io Group name now can't access account


Michael Miehl
 

Good evening.

I am new to and just made a mistake that prevents me from accessing my account.

I am the group owner and paid for the $220 subscription. In an effort to make it easier for folks to send messages to our group, I changed the name. BIG MISTAKE!! Since I changed the name I'm getting a "can't find the server" error from my web browser when I try to access it as an administrator (not sure what others are experiencing who want to send messages). But of course, the that I paid for has the old name and the new one isn't recognized. Anyone have a clue how I can go back and change the group name to the one I originally registered? I can't get into my account to do this. I can see the group under "my groups" but when I click on it I get the error.?

This seems like it should have been much harder to do this - change the name of our group (after having paid for it, etc.) and therefore lock oneself out of the account. I'll keep trying to see what I can do but wanted to reach out to your group for help.

I appreciate your advice.?

First of all, here's the help page on changing your group name. By looking at that, you might see where you went wrong.
/helpcenter/ownersmanual/1/renaming-groups?single=true

It may be that there is a delay before your new group name is on the server.
That help page says:

Note:?

It might take some time for the renamed group to function normally because, due to the subdomain addressing used by Groups.io, any change to the root email address has to be propagated through the DNS entries (so the new group URL resolves into an IP address). This process can take several hours.

Renaming your main group also changes the URL of any associated subgroups.
